The phrase are matched below according to the literary technique that was used.
What is a literary technique?Any distinctive element of literature or a specific work that we can recognize, identify, interpret, and/or analyze is referred to as a literary device.
The matched phrase are?1) Alliteration is used in "Grim and greedy, he grasped".
If the same letter or sound appears at the beginning of two or more words that are closely related, alliteration has occurred. In this instance, you can see how the letters "gr" are repeated to create the repeating sound [gr].
2) Synecdoche is used in "The Wale-path".
A synecdoche is a device used in figurative language to express one thing while referring to a different, related subject. The term "The Wale-path" originally meant "the sea," not "the route." Metonymy is frequently used in synecdoche, as it is in this instance.
3) Kenning is used in "they drive their keels o'er the darkling wave".
Kenning hailed from the poetry of the Anglo-Saxons. This literary device typically appears as a two-word phrase that uses metaphors to describe objects. This phrasing is really borrowed from the Anglo-Saxon poem "Beowulf," which is a good example of the style.
4) Epithet is used in "the ruler-of-man".
Epithet often takes the form of an adjective or phrase that describes a trait of the character being discussed. An attribute of a person is contained in this sentence.
